[Qemu-devel] [PATCH v3 1/3] qemu-timer: drop outdated signal safety comments |
Date: |
Thu, 29 Aug 2013 16:42:47 +0200 |
host_alarm_handler() is invoked from the signal processing thread
(currently the iothread). Previously we did processing in a real signal
handler with signalfd and therefore needed signal-safe timer code.
Today host_alarm_handler() just marks the alarm timer as expired/pending
and notifies the main loop using qemu_notify_event().
Therefore these outdated comments about signal safety can be dropped.
